The Process of Obtaining a Driving License
Obtaining a driving license in Germany involves several actions, which can differ slightly depending on the category of the license. Below is a basic outline of the procedure:

Determine Eligibility: Ensure you meet the minimum age and health requirements. A medical checkup might be essential for particular classes (like C and D).

Register in a Driving School: Choose a local driving school (Fahrschule) that is certified to teach the particular classification you want to acquire. The school will assist you with theoretical and practical lessons.

Total Theory Lessons: Attend the necessary variety of theory lessons, which cover traffic rules and regulations. After conclusion, you'll sit for a theoretical examination.

Pass Theoretical Exam: Successfully pass the theory exam, which consists of multiple-choice questions.

Practical Driving Training: Engage in practical driving lessons to get hands-on experience. The variety of needed classes will depend upon your previous experience and convenience level.

4. Renewing and Replacing Your License
German driving licenses typically stand for 15 years. To maintain your driving benefits, it is important to restore your license before it ends. Here's how to do it:
Renewal Process: Visit the local Führerscheinstelle with needed files, consisting of ID, expired license, and a passport picture. Charges: Expect to pay a renewal cost, which can differ by area.Replacement: If lost or stolen, a replacement can be asked for utilizing the same procedure as renewal.5. Driving with a Foreign License
For non-EU people, driving in Germany on a foreign license is allowed for as much as 6 months. After this period, one must either:

Exchange the License: Some countries have arrangements that enable for direct exchange of licenses. Check if your home nation is on the list to prevent retesting.

Obtain a German License: If your license can not be exchanged, you will require to go through the full licensing process in Germany.

Q1: Can I drive in Germany with a global driving authorization?Yes, a global driving authorization (IDP) is acknowledged in Germany, but it ought to be used in conjunction with your home country's driving license.

Q2: What are the charges for driving without a valid license?Driving without a valid license can result in substantial fines, points on your driving record, and potential legal action.

Q3: Are there particular rules for new drivers?Yes, new drivers (under 21) face stricter limitations on blood alcohol content (0.0%). In addition, there is a probationary period of 2 years throughout which stricter penalties apply for traffic violations.

Q4: What coverage do I require for driving in Germany?Liability insurance coverage is mandatory, while detailed insurance is suggested for additional protection.

Q5: How long does it take to obtain a driving license in Germany?The period varies based on private preparation and scheduling, however the whole procedure typically takes several months.
